Was kann ich tun, um die Performance zu erhöhen?

Falls Sie Performance-Probleme bei der Verwendung von Neuron Power Engineer haben, empfiehlt Ihnen Neuron zum Prüfen der folgenden Punkte:

Problem

Details

Allgemeine Performance-Probleme sind bei der Verwendung von Neuron Power Engineer bemerkbar.

Ursache: Der Windows 10 Defender scannt die in Neuron Power Engineer enthaltenen JAR-Dateien und verlangsamt Neuron Power Engineer erheblich.

Zusätzliche Informationen: Neuron Power Engineer basiert auf einem Release der Eclipse Foundation (siehe "Elemente der Entwicklungsumgebung" für Details). Das Problem mit dem Windows 10 Defender ist als Eclipse-Problem gemeldet worden unter: https://bugs.eclipse.org/bugs/show_bug.cgi?id=548443

Abhilfe: Fügen Sie die Hauptordner von Neuron Power Engineer zur Ausschlussliste von Windows 10 Defender hinzu:

  1. Öffnen Sie die Einstellungen von Windows 10.

  2. Suchen Sie nach Viren- & Bedrohungsschutz und öffnen Sie diese Einstellungen.

  3. Klicken Sie nun auf Einstellungen verwalten im Abschnitt Einstellungen für Viren- & Bedrohungsschutz.

  4. Klicken Sie nun im Abschnitt Ausschlüsse auf Ausschlüsse hinzufügen oder entfernen.

  5. Klicken Sie nun auf Ausschluss hinzufügen und wählen Sie Ordner.

  6. Zeigen Sie auf den jeweiligen Neuron Power Engineer Hauptordner und drücken Sie Ordner auswählen.
    Die Hauptordner von Neuron Power Engineer sind:

    • der Installationsorder (= der Ordner, in dem Neuron Power Engineer installiert wurde)

    • der Ordner für den Arbeitsbereich (= der Ordner, der für den Arbeitsbereich beim Starten von Neuron Power Engineer angegeben wurde) und

    • der/die Ordner mit den Neuron Power Engineer-→Projekten

Die Projekt-Aktionen verursachen Wartezeiten.

Siehe "Die Projekt-Aktionen dauern lange."

Windows-Sicherheitshinweise erscheinen beim Starten von Neuron Power Engineer oder beim Laden der Anwendung.

Siehe "Die Windows-Firewall blockiert Funktionen des Programms."

Das Speichern von Editoren dauert lange. Diese Editoren enthalten viele private Elementen.

Mit Hilfe der Konfigurationsvariable lc3.removeLocalVariablesFromIndexer können Sie die Performance beim Speichern von Editoren erhöhen. Die Konfigurationsvariable wirkt sich vor allem aus, falls Sie →Funktionsbausteine mit privaten →Variablen und privaten →Funktionsbaustein-Instanzen in Ihrer Anwendung haben.

Mit dem Wert TRUE für diese Konfigurationsvariable werden nämlich Funktionsbausteine mit privaten Variablen und privaten Funktionsbaustein-Instanzen nicht beim Aktualisieren der Anwendung berücksichtigt. Dieses Aktualisieren der Anwendung wird automatisch beim Speichern des Editors ausgelöst.

Beachten Sie: Private Variablen und privaten Funktionsbaustein-Instanzen sind jene Elemente, die mit dem Schlüsselwort PRIVATE im Funktionsbaustein deklariert sind. Wenn das Standard-Verhalten auf PRIVATE geändert wurde, sind es auch jene Elemente, die ohne ein Schlüsselwort für die Sichtbarkeit deklariert sind. Details: Siehe "Deklaration von internen Variablen" und "Deklaration von Funktionsbaustein-Instanzen in ST".

Aktionen im ST-Editor sind langsam.

Siehe "ST-Editor reagiert langsam."

Das Speichern eines FBS-Editor mit vielen Seiten dauert lange.

Siehe "Kann ich die Performance beim Speichern des FBS-Editors erhöhen?".

Neuron Power Engineer wird gar nicht gestartet, die Anwendung kann nicht erstellt/geladen werden.

Ursache: Ihr Virenscanner unterbindet das Starten oder das Erstellen/Laden der Anwendung.
Siehe "Entwicklungsumgebung kann nicht gestartet werden, es wird keine Fehlermeldung angezeigt." und "Anwendung kann nicht erstellt oder geladen werden"